Web18 dec. 2024 · Hyundai Accent – (Renovacio / Shutterstock) The most common signs of bad mass air flow sensor (MAF) in Hyundai Accent are loss of power or slow acceleration, engine hesitation or jerking during acceleration, erratic idling, misfires, poor exhaust emission values and sometimes black smoke comes out of the tailpipe. If you're thinking about using a used accent, you should know how long they can last. On average, the Hyundai Accent can easily cross more than 200,000 miles or 10 to 15 years, depending on maintenance and mileage. Hyundai Accents are very reliable cars. S spankie14 Registered Joined Apr 11, 2002 459 Posts on one whole sheet of paperWeb3 mrt. 2024 · A Hyundai Accent will last 200,000 miles with regular maintenance. Based on driving an average of 13,500 miles per year, you can expect a Hyundai Accent to last about 15 years. Continue reading to find out how the Hyundai Accent compares to similar subcompact cars.
